AES-IP-3X SCA Resistant AES Accelerator Family Product Brief
The Rambus SCA-resistant AES-IP-3X family of crypto accelerator cores provide semiconductor manufacturers with superior AES cipher acceleration. The cores are easily integrated into ASIC/SoC and FPGA devices and offer a high-level of resistance to various Side Channel Attacks like Differential Power Analysis (DPA), and optionally offer detection of Fault Injection Attacks (FIA).
SCA Resistant Hardware Cores Product Brief
Rambus SCA (Side Channel Attack) Resistant Hardware Cores prevent against the leakage of secret cryptographic key material through DPA (Differential Power Analysis) and against sabotage through FIA (Fault Injection Attacks) when integrated into an SoC. These superior performance cores are easily integrated into SoCs and FPGAs, providing robust side-channel resistance across different security and performance levels.
